Former head of Colombia's infra agency under house arrest
The former head of Colombia's infrastructure agency ANI, Luis Andrade, was placed under house arrest by a judge who is investigating whether he exerted undue influence when signing an addendum to a now cancelled highway contract with construction company Odebrecht.
The investigation is part of a wider probe into bribes paid by the Brazilian firm in the country.
Andrade, who resigned from his post at ANI in August shortly after it was revealed he would be charged with undue influence in granting contracts, also allegedly instructed his "confidant " Juan Correa to keep a visitors log in his office. In the log, visits of congressman Miguel Elías, also investigated in the Odebrecht scandal, were erased, a press release from the prosecutor's office says.
The prosecutors quote an August 22 statement from Correa in which he says that Andrade told him to say that he only met with representatives from Odebrecht once at Elías' apartment.
According to the same statement, Andrade went to Elías' apartment at least five times, and that in those meetings Eleuberto Antonio Martorelli, Odebrecht's representative in Colombia, was also present.
The addendum to the now cancelled Ruta del Sol 2 concession entailed the 82km Ocaña-Gamarra stretch.
